Climb Kebnekaise

If you are fascinated by mountain climbing, then you need to try the Scandinavian Mountains in Northern Sweden. One of them is the Kebnekaise, which receives many visitors during all times of the year. Standing 2,106 metres high, this is the highest mountain in the entire country, and it provides you with a spectacular view of the place when you get to the top.
